3‑Day Kurnool to Visakhapatnam (Vizag) Adventure

Viewed by 70 travelers

Day 1: Journey & Beachside Arrival

Morning: Depart Kurnool early by car or bus, enjoying the scenic drive through the Eastern Ghats (≈350 km, 6‑7 hours). Stop at a highway dhaba for a quick breakfast and stretch.

Afternoon: Arrive in Visakhapatnam, check into your hotel near RK Beach, and unwind with a light lunch featuring fresh seafood.

Evening: Stroll along RK Beach at sunset, explore the nearby Submarine Museum (INS Kurush), and savor dinner at a beachfront restaurant.

Day 2: City Highlights

Morning: Take the ropeway up to Kailasagiri Hill for panoramic city and sea views, then wander through its gardens and sculptures.

Afternoon: Visit the historic Dolphin’s Nose viewpoint and the adjoining Udayagiri & Kothavalasa Caves, followed by lunch at a local eatery serving Andhra thali.

Evening: Explore the vibrant Indira Gandhi Zoological Park before heading back to the hotel for a relaxing evening on the promenade.

Day 3: Araku Valley Excursion & Return

Morning: Board a scenic train or drive to Araku Valley, enjoying the lush coffee plantations and the famous Borra Caves en route.

Afternoon: Explore the tribal museum, sip a cup of locally grown coffee, and have a picnic lunch amid the rolling hills.

Evening: Return to Vizag, freshen up, and catch an evening train or bus back to Kurnool, marking the end of your trip.

Time and Cost Estimates

  • Travel Kurnool → Vizag (road/bus) – 7 hrs – ₹1,200
  • RK Beach & Submarine Museum – 2 hrs – ₹150
  • Kailasagiri Ropeway – 1.5 hrs – ₹300
  • Dolphin’s Nose & Udayagiri Caves – 2 hrs – ₹200
  • Indira Gandhi Zoological Park – 2 hrs – ₹250
  • Araku Valley Day Trip (incl. Borra Caves) – 6 hrs – ₹800
  • Meals (breakfast, lunch, dinner ×3 days) – 9 hrs – ₹1,500
  • Accommodation (2 nights) – 48 hrs – ₹2,200
  • Local transport (auto‑rickshaws, taxis) – 5 hrs – ₹600
  • Miscellaneous (souvenirs, tips) – — – ₹500
  • Total Estimated Cost: ₹7,000

Tips

To extend the trip, add an extra day in Araku to visit the Tribal Museum and enjoy a plantation‑tour coffee tasting session. If you need to shorten the itinerary, skip the evening visit to the zoological park and use that time for a relaxed dinner at the beach, reducing both travel fatigue and expenses.
